Abstract
The utility model discloses a kind of airtight detecting instrument cabinets, including pedestal, power control cabinet on pedestal, the power control cabinet is equipped with airtight detector, the airtight detector side is equipped with base, the base is equipped with code reader and printer, the printer includes cabinet, operation panel, cover, exit slot, the cabinet is arranged in base upper end, the cover is arranged in cabinet upper end, the cover and cabinet are articulated connection, the operation panel is arranged in cabinet front end, the exit slot is arranged in operation panel side, the base front end is equipped with push button panel, the power control cabinet lateral inner is equipped with three linked piece and power switch, pedestal lower end four corners are respectively equipped with movable pulley, the airtight detector upper end is provided with three chromatograph lamps.The purpose of the utility model is to provide a kind of airtight detecting instrument cabinet, can be carved characters automatically, the printing of two dimensional code is pasted, the production cost for improving detection efficiency, saving enterprise.

The three linked piece includes three kinds of air filter, pressure reducing valve, oil sprayer gas source processing elements, to enter pneumatic instrument
The gas source purification of table filters and is decompressed to specified bleed pressure, and the gas source transformer being equivalent in circuit can carry out gas source
Pressure stabilizing makes gas source be in steady state, and damage when can reduce because of gas source mutation to hardware such as valve or actuators, filter is used
In the cleaning to gas source, it may filter that the moisture content in compressed air, moisture content avoided to enter device with gas.Oil sprayer can transport body
Dynamic component is lubricated, and can be lubricated to the component for being inconvenient to add lubricating oil, be greatly prolonged the service life of body.

Working method:
It turns on the power switch the airtight detector 3 of 9 drivings, printer 2, code reader 14 to be acted accordingly, air-tightness inspection
It surveys instrument 3 and the detection of air-tightness part is carried out to workpiece, the air-tightness parameter for the workpiece that then air-leakage detector 3 detects is sent to control
Device processed, if meeting preset standard parameter, the air tightness of workpiece is qualified, and printer 2 prints outgoing label, then closes to detection
The workpiece of lattice is labelled, and label is one-dimension code and two dimensional code, scans the label information on workpiece, workpiece using code reader 14
On label information be sent to controller, if the air tightness of workpiece detected is unqualified, printer 2 without labelling.
